José THE FOOL

A kid who wanted to be Elvis
Stole his daddy's guitar 
Other kids on the block, took their parents car
José always felt a little different
Eating lunch in the bathroom of his school
Always the new kid, his part in the play, always the fool

You can only be fired so many times
Before you feel like everyone's right
How many eviction notices does it take?
How many hits till a dreamin heart breaks?

José never claimed to be the good guy
Till one night he had his chance
Guitar strapped to his back, bell bottom Elvis pants
Down an alleyway to the spot he always played
Women screams out to be saved!
José never thought twice
Some say that's what cost him his life

You can only be fired so many times
Before you feel like everyone's right
How many eviction notices does it take?
How many hits till a dreamin heart breaks?
